iTeos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:ITOS – Get Free Report) was the recipient of a large increase in short interest in the month of March. As of March 31st, there was short interest totalling 1,830,000 shares, an increase of 33.6% from the March 15th total of 1,370,000 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 313,200 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 5.8 days. Currently, 5.5% of the company’s stock are short sold.

About iTeos Therapeutics
iTeos Therapeutics, Inc is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, which engages in the discovery and development of a new generation of immuno-oncology therapeutics for people living with cancer. Its pipeline includes EOS-448, Inupadenant, and EOS-984. The company was founded by Michel Detheux in April 2012 and is headquartered in Watertown, MA.
